Output e2fc86af9797b15c0fcefd3401e984033ee4d8328390626193cd7d7497a186d8:0

value
1705656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 899618afad0df8055e02b05ecbaa108baa628491 OP_EQUAL
address
3EEWJhynAgVp8PZvA4sgCFf79jEPHuNZPe
transaction
e2fc86af9797b15c0fcefd3401e984033ee4d8328390626193cd7d7497a186d8
spent
true